Question
Find the largest four-digit number which when divided
by 6, 10, 15, and 18, leaves a remainder 1, 5, 10, and 13 respectively.Solution
Here we can see that the difference (5) between numbers and remainder is same along all four numbers. 6 = 2 × 3
10 = 2 × 5
15 = 3 × 5
18 = 2 × 3² LCM of (6, 10, 15, 18) = 2 × 3² × 5
= 90 Largest four-digit number which is a multiple of 90 = 9,990 So, the required number = 9990 − 5 = 9,985
